Government agencies seem to be at odds regarding the future of the EDSA bus carousel, a public transportation system in Metro Manila . While the Department of Transportation (DOTr) maintains its belief in the system's efficiency and advocates for its continued operation, some agencies, including the MMDA, propose scrapping it. The DOTr cites the EDSA bus carousel's ability to transport over 63 million commuters in 2024 and 5.

5 million in January 2025 alone, highlighting its effectiveness in alleviating traffic congestion on EDSA, with each bus carrying up to 54 passengers. They argue that the dedicated lane system offers faster travel times and a safer experience for commuters compared to regular traffic. However, proponents of scrapping the system, such as the MMDA, propose converting the dedicated bike lanes into shared lanes for motorcycles, citing underutilization of the current bike lanes. This discrepancy in viewpoints stems from differing priorities and approaches. The DOTr emphasizes the EDSA bus carousel's contribution to efficient public transportation and its role in reducing traffic congestion. They plan to expand the system, with bidding for the EDSA bus carousel scheduled to begin in 2025. Conversely, agencies like the MMDA focus on alternative solutions, such as shared motorcycle lanes, to improve mobility and address perceived inefficiencies in the current bike lane infrastructure.Adding further complexity to the situation is the proposal to implement a congestion fee for four-wheeled vehicles using EDSA, a suggestion put forth by the Department of Transportation (DOTr) Secretary Jaime Bautista. This move aims to discourage private vehicle usage and incentivize the adoption of public transportation. The DOTr also stated that they plan to study the suggestion to open bike lanes for mixed use with motorcycles further before making any decisions. This conflicting stance towards the EDSA bus carousel underscores the challenges in finding unified solutions for improving transportation infrastructure in Metro Manila
